141039meatrowGrowing Vegetable is Fun 3 (JOI19_ho_t3)C++17
100 / 100
246 ms6912 KiB
//#pragma GCC optimize("O3")
//#pragma GCC target("sse,sse2,sse3,ssse3,sse4,popcnt,abm,mmx,tune=native")
//#pragma GCC optimize ("unroll-loops")
#include <bits/stdc++.h>

using namespace std;

using ll = long long;
using ld = long double;

const int N = 405;

int dp[N][N][4][2];
int cnt[3];
int n;
int suf[N][N][3];

void init(int q) {
    for (int i = 0; i < N; i++) {
        for (int j = 0; j < N; j++) {
            for (int t = 0; t < 4; t++) {
                dp[i][j][t][q] = INT32_MAX;
            }
        }
    }
}

int main() {
    ios::sync_with_stdio(false);
    cin.tie(nullptr);
    cout.tie(nullptr);
    cin >> n;
    map<char, int> mp;
    mp['R'] = 0;
    mp['G'] = 1;
    mp['Y'] = 2;
    string s;
    cin >> s;
    vector<int> pos[3];
    for (int i = 0; i < n; i++) {
        cnt[mp[s[i]]]++;
        pos[mp[s[i]]].push_back(i);
    }
    for (int i = 0; i < 3; i++) {
        pos[i].push_back(-1);
        reverse(pos[i].begin(), pos[i].end());
    }
    for (int t = 0; t < 3; t++) {
        for (int j = 0; j < n; j++) {
            for (int i = 1; i <= cnt[t]; i++) {
                suf[i][j][t] = suf[i - 1][j][t] + (pos[t][i] < j);
            }
        }
    }
    init(0);
    dp[cnt[0]][cnt[1]][3][0] = 0;
    for (int i = 0; i < n; i++) {
        int q = i & 1;
        int w = q ^ 1;
        init(w);
        for (int j = 0; j <= cnt[0]; j++) {
            for (int k = 0; k <= min(n - i - j, cnt[1]); k++) {
                for (int t = 0; t < 4; t++) {
                    if (dp[j][k][t][q] == INT32_MAX) {
                        continue;
                    }
                    if (j > 0 && t != 0) {
                        dp[j - 1][k][0][w] = min(dp[j - 1][k][0][w], dp[j][k][t][q] + suf[k][pos[0][j]][1] + suf[n - i - j - k][pos[0][j]][2]);
                    }
                    if (k > 0 && t != 1) {
                        dp[j][k - 1][1][w] = min(dp[j][k - 1][1][w], dp[j][k][t][q] + suf[j][pos[1][k]][0] + suf[n - i - j - k][pos[1][k]][2]);
                    }
                    if (n - i - j - k > 0 && t != 2) {
                        dp[j][k][2][w] = min(dp[j][k][2][w], dp[j][k][t][q] + suf[j][pos[2][n - i - j - k]][0] + suf[k][pos[2][n - i - j - k]][1]);
                    }
                }
            }
        }
    }
    int ans = INT32_MAX;
    for (int i = 0; i < 4; i++) {
        ans = min(ans, dp[0][0][i][n & 1]);
    }
    if (ans == INT32_MAX) {
        cout << -1;
    } else {
        cout << ans;
    }
    return 0;
}
